Choose Materials Built for Durability
For a strong exterior, focus on components that work together. Select roofing systems designed for impact resistance and reliable weather shedding, and ensure proper ventilation and underlayment are included in the scope. For walls, prioritize corrosion-resistant fasteners, quality flashing details around penetrations, and tight sealing at transitions. Inspection and Repair Workflow for Weather Risks
Even a new build benefits from a structured inspection routine, especially after severe weather. A approach typically includes checking shingles and metal panels for dents, examining flashing around vents and edges, and verifying that seals remain intact. It also helps to look for signs of interior moisture because leaks often start at the roofline before they show up inside. When damage is identified, repair should follow an order of operations: address compromised roof components first, confirm flashing and drainage details, then verify the attic or interior areas are dry and protected. This workflow helps prevent recurring issues and supports a smoother restoration process.
